How much do trade show event staff jobs pay per year?
As of Sep 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for trade show event staff in the United States is $54,604.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$39,500.00 and $71,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.
Trade Show Event Staff are professionals hired to assist with the planning, setup, operation, and breakdown of booths or exhibits at trade shows and conventions. Their responsibilities often include greeting attendees, distributing promotional materials, answering questions about products or services, and helping with event logistics. They play a critical role in ensuring a company's booth runs smoothly and creates a positive impression on potential clients or partners. Depending on the event, they may also collect leads, demonstrate products, or manage crowd flow. Overall, Trade Show Event Staff help enhance the experience for both exhibitors and attendees.
To thrive as Trade Show Event Staff, you need str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and basic knowledge of event operations, often supported by prior experience in hospitality or sales. Familiarity with lead retrieval software, event registration platforms, and point-of-sale systems is commonly required. Outstanding interpersonal communication, adaptability, and teamwork help individuals excel in engaging attendees and supporting exhibitors. These skills are crucial for creating positive event experiences, ensuring smooth operations, and maximizing lead generation at trade shows.
Trade Show Event Staff often deal with fast-paced environments, last-minute changes, and high volumes of attendee interactions. Managing these challenges requires adaptability, strong communication skills, and teamwork to ensure smooth operations. Being proactive in troubleshooting issues, such as technical difficulties or attendee concerns, and maintaining a positive attitude under pressure are key to delivering a successful event experience. Collaborating closely with other staff members and event coordinators helps to quickly resolve problems and keep the event running efficiently.
